Natco International Inc.: Photo Violation Wins "Best of Show" at the Worlds Biggest Parking Trade Show

Natco International Inc. announces that Photo Violation Technologies Corp. is honored to be named "Best of Show" by the International Parking Institute ("IPI") at the 2007 Trade show.
Mr. Raj-Mohinder Gurm, President of NATCO (OTCBB:NCII), announces that Photo Violation Technologies Corp. ("PVT"), a company that will take over NATCO pursuant to an executed binding Letter of Agreement, is honored to be named "Best of Show" by the International Parking Institute("IPI") at 2007 Trade show themed "Expanding the Synergy of Technology". PVT beat out several well-established industry leaders to win the Best of Show Award at the World's largest Parking Industry tradeshow of the year. The PhotoViolationMeterPBS is the first and only Patented Self Enforcing meter that handles multiple parking spaces. The PBS Combines the original Photo Violation VehicleSensorPuck (VSP) with the new VehicleCameraPuck (VCP). When the VSP detects a vehicle, it will communicate with the PBSTM and alerts the VehicleCameraPuck (VCP), which captures the license plate of a vehicle in violation. Used in conjunction with the VehicleSensorPuck (VSP) and the VehicleCameraPuck the PhotoViolationMeterPBS (PBS) will capture 100% of the violations. The PhotoViolationMeterPBS offers all the user friendly benefits of the PhotoViolationMeter, including the Every Way to Pay, No Fine, and the Grace Period feature. The PBS also issues violations automatically, and allows drivers to pay their fines at a reduced rate right at the meter with the PayYourFine Feature.

Photo Violation now is the only company to offer a complete self enforcing solution for Cities whether it is traditional parking meters or one multi-space meter that handles multiple parking spaces.

Visitors at the booth were just as intrigued by another of Photo Violation's new products the Self Enforcing VehicleCameraSensorPuck. The Photo Violation VehicleCameraSensorPuck (VCSP) integrates the vehicle sensor, camera technology and wireless communications into one unit to self enforce parking regulations. Cities can place these pucks in red (No Parking), Bus zones where vehicle are prohibited from parking. Any vehicles detected and that violate parking regulations will have its license plate captured, and a photo violation issued automatically.
